Physical law-2:Salting gel method/Membrane separation method
1.4, Salting gel method
In the PVA wastewater treatment process, salting gel method can be used. That is, according to the characteristics of PVA, the salting-out agent sodium sulfate and the gelling agent borax are added into the waste water so that the borax reacts with the PVA molecules to form the PVA-borax diol type structure. Under the action of Na + and SO42-, Through its powerful water and ability to absorb a large amount of water around, making PVA dehydration from the precipitation of waste water.
The results showed that the dosage of sodium sulfate and borax were 14g / L and 1.4g / L respectively when the concentration of PVA in wastewater was 12g / L, and the reaction time was controlled for 20min , The reaction temperature is 50 ¡æ, the initial pH of the solution is 8.5 ~ 9.5, the recovery rate of PVA is more than 90%.
Polyvinyl alcohol in textile printing and dyeing desizing wastewater was treated and recovered by chemical coagulation method. PVA and PVA recovery rate and COD removal rate in the productive scale recovery wastewater were all successfully reached about 80%.
Study on the Recovery of PVA in Desizing Wastewater by Condensation. The results showed that the recovery rate of PVA batch reaction was up to 90%. On this basis, the PVA continuous recovery process was achieved with the recovery rate of 80%.
